


Passorosso DOC Etna Rosso - 2019
An amalgamation of Nerello Mascalese grapes grown at various heights on Etna's northern flank. The higher elevations are typically located on gravelly soils with a coarser grain size, while the lower elevations are typically situated on finer and deeper soils composed of ancient lava flows that have now been oxidized and reduced to lava dust. This wine captures the essence of multiple distinct regions within a single bottle, providing an all-encompassing sense of place. The 2019 Passorosso effortlessly releases a heady bouquet of roses and cherries. It has a velvety texture with a refreshingly cool undercurrent of acidity and sweetness, making for an alluringly lively and fruit-forward flavor. The 2019 finishes strong, with lingering notes of spiced citrus and firm red candies giving way to a coating of round tannins that give the wine a characteristic dry texture.

- Climate:A late ripening year on Mt. Etna as well, the vintage was characterized by a decidedly cold spring during April and May, with a light frost over May 6 7. This persistent cold weather continued until the end of May without interruption, causing a significant delay in flowering, which itself continued until the middle of June.

- Fermentation:After destemming and pressing, the must macerates for around 15 days. A pie de cuve starts fermentation in stainless steel, and a submerged cap extrapolates fruity notes without exaggerating tannins.
- Elevage:12 months in concrete tanks, 6 months in big oak casks. Bottling takes place in waning moon June.
